Crowdsourced: 6 Steps To Reduce Side Effects From Interferons (Infographic)

Posted on November 30, 2016

On MyMSTeam, members shared the steps they take before, during and after Interferon injections to reduce pain and side effects. We realized that there's a ritual many MSers follow -- tested and tried steps to take during each injection that help reduce injection site pain and side effects.

One of our members said, “If I stay hydrated and pre-medicate with ibuprofen, it isn’t really too bad,” (31yr. old woman, dx Relapse/Remitting MS in 2011). Others find less pain when they inject after taking the pen or syringe out of the refrigerator and waiting until it is at room temperature.

We put together this 6-step ritual to ease the process of Interferon injections. Some of the tips include planning recovery time, hydrating, and pre-medicating with over-the-counter pain relievers before the injection.
